Shows nowadays haven't got any soul. There's no lesson to be learnt, no real challenge to be overcome and absolutely no new stories. I'm horrified by things like how devoid of a moral compass a lot of these modern day kids shows are,meow they seem to be an experiment in throwing as much random cramp as they can get away with into an episode with no need for explanations and things like just how bland and personality free new Disney cartoons are. Nothing at all to latch onto. Whilst shows like aren't and Stimoy and Rockos Modern Life started pushing the random barriers back in the day they still had story lines that went with it.
The message these days seems to be stab everyone in the back and cry and you should achieve your dreams as evidenced by The Voice and Masterchef and The Block and all of their ilk. They actively promote bad sportsmanship and downright encourage going for the sympathy vote over actually being talented.
